Description
708 provinces : 500 land and 57 sea and 83 caves and 68 chaotic, distributed across 3 planes
Work In Progress

This map is based on Warhammer Fantasy universe, especially based on the XXIIIth, XXIVth and beginning of XXVth centuries Imperial Calendar.

This map is the most extensive map in the series of Warhammer maps that I create, which are more detailed/in-zoomed than any other Warhammer's maps previously published in workshop, but doesn't include New World (Naggaroth and Lustria), Ulthuan, Southlands, Inja/Ind, Khuresh, Nippon and Cathay.

- 1° The main plane is a revealed and non-wraparoundable map (a flat map) including the entire Old World, stretching from the Great Ocean in the west to the Mountains of Mourn in the east, from Araby and Nehekhara in the south to the Chaos Wastes/Desolations in the north.
The map image is from the website https://wjrf.bimondiens.com/content/maps/index.php.

- 2° The second plane is a hidden and non-wraparoundable map (a flat map), composed of caves for all the tunnel networks dug by the Dwarves, called “the Underway of the Ungdrin Angkor” with their citadels, particularly in the World's Edge Mountains, as well as the Skavendom, the Under-Empire of the Skavens.

- 3° The third dimension is a hidden map, both wraparoundable (an aberration permitted by this infernal, phantasmagorical, and magical dimension) which represent the Realms of Chaos, containing the Lands of the Plaguelord, the Blood God's Domain, the Realm of the Great Sorcerer, and the Dark Prince's Realm.
The map picture is an illustration of the Realms of Chaos found in the Tome of Corruption (official Warhammer book about Chaos). It is a map of the Realms of Chaos made by Marius Holseher in his grimoire, the “Liber Malefic”, following his dreamlike or real (?) journey through Realms of Chaos, due to a mysterious fever or an Arabian artifact (?).

No throne placed as a site (unlike HCAM, for example), random generation.

(continuation of the previous message, as I am limited to 1000 characters per message)
You can still assign a spawn point to Ulthuan (ID=152) by adding a line #specstart 152 followed by the number of the desired province at the end of the .MAP file on your computer.
Vesporium  [author] 8 hours ago 
@POVILUS: I have not assigned a spawn point to Ulthuan. However, depending on the other nations you have chosen in the game, this will leave only a few starters available for unassigned nations, such as Ulthuan.
For each nation or modnation (for each ID to be precise, hence some problems between incompatible mods), I can only assign a single spawn point (however, several nations can share the same one, which will prevent them from both being in the same game).
I have listed all the modnations and starters in the description and on the images in the article.
If you have included all the other modnations from Sombre Warhammer, then there is still Magritta (with MA Quijote, for those who would like the Estalians separated from the Tileans), Al-Haikk, and a province of the Haunted Forest.
I guess you have tried a game without Na'Ba, which I have included to represent the Arabians.
